首页 > 编程语言
Javabean
Javabean简介 Javabeans就是符合某种特定的规范的Java类。 使用Javabeans的好处是解决代码重复编写,减少代码冗余,功能区分明确,提高了代码的维护性。 Javabean的设计原则 设计学生类 什么是JSP动作? JSP动作元素(action elements),动作元素为请求 ...
分类:编程语言   时间:2017-06-16 09:35:38    收藏:0  评论:0  赞:0  阅读:311
Java中RMI远程调用demo
Java远程方法调用,即Java RMI(Java Remote Method Invocation),一种用于实现远程过程调用的应用程序编程接口。它使客户机上运行的程序可以调用远程服务器上的对象。远程方法调用特性使Java编程人员能够在网络环境中分布操作。RMI全部的宗旨就是尽可能简化远程接口对象 ...
分类:编程语言   时间:2017-06-16 09:33:36    收藏:0  评论:0  赞:0  阅读:299
如何从二维数组中的多个key中获取指定key的值?
精华 LOVEME96 2016-10-21 10:40:19 浏览(1512) 回答(3) 赞(0) 新手求教:二维数组中一般会有多个key,如果我们要获得指定key的值,应该怎么做? 问题标签: php 精华 LOVEME96 2016-10-21 10:40:19 浏览(1512) 回答(3) ...
分类:编程语言   时间:2017-06-16 09:33:11    收藏:0  评论:0  赞:0  阅读:579
SpringMVC返回json数据的三种方式
SpringMVC返回json数据的三种方式:http://blog.csdn.net/shan9liang/article/details/42181345 上述第三种方法:可能会出现这个jar包没有的情况,引入即可,下面pom引入即可 java.lang.NoClassDefFoundError ...
分类:编程语言   时间:2017-06-16 09:29:32    收藏:0  评论:0  赞:0  阅读:358
hadoop +streaming 排序总结
参考http://blog.csdn.net/baidu_zhongce/article/details/49210787 hadoop用于对key的排序和分桶的设置选项比较多,在公司中主要以KeyFieldBasePartitioner和KeyFieldBaseComparator被hadoop用 ...
分类:编程语言   时间:2017-06-16 09:29:17    收藏:0  评论:0  赞:0  阅读:295
多线程和异步编程示例和实践-踩过的坑
上两篇文章,主要介绍了Thread、ThreadPool和TPL 多线程异步编程示例和实践-Thread和ThreadPool 多线程异步编程示例和实践-Task 本文中,分享两则我们在做多线程和异步编程中实际踩过的坑,实际生产环境遇到的问题,以及解决办法。 1. HttpClient 业务场景:使 ...
分类:编程语言   时间:2017-06-16 09:26:10    收藏:0  评论:0  赞:0  阅读:337
spring如何控制事务
Spring 的事务,可以说是 Spring AOP 的一种实现。 AOP面向切面编程,即在不修改源代码的情况下,对原有功能进行扩展,通过代理类来对具体类进行操作。 spring是一个容器,通过spring这个容器来对对象进行管理,根据配置文件来实现spring对对象的管理。 spring的事务声明 ...
分类:编程语言   时间:2017-06-16 09:25:56    收藏:0  评论:0  赞:0  阅读:233
16、Java并发性和多线程-死锁
以下内容转自http://ifeve.com/deadlock/: 死锁是两个或更多线程阻塞着等待其它处于死锁状态的线程所持有的锁。死锁通常发生在多个线程同时但以不同的顺序请求同一组锁的时候。 例如,如果线程1锁住了A,然后尝试对B进行加锁,同时线程2已经锁住了B,接着尝试对A进行加锁,这时死锁就发 ...
分类:编程语言   时间:2017-06-16 09:24:21    收藏:0  评论:0  赞:0  阅读:307
Java之io nio aio 的区别
这个问题最近面试总是遇到,作为一个只会写流水代码的程序员,一脸懵逼。看了网上的解释,看的还是很模糊,说下我对这个的理解。 先引出一个话题,两个大水缸,一个空一个满,让你把一个缸里面的水弄到另一个里面。 io:同步阻塞,最蠢的办法,拿个水瓢,盛水,来回跑。 nio:同步非阻塞,先来一根水管。水管一头放 ...
分类:编程语言   时间:2017-06-16 09:23:12    收藏:0  评论:0  赞:0  阅读:358
6、Java并发性和多线程-并发性与并行性
以下内容转自http://tutorials.jenkov.com/java-concurrency/concurrency-vs-parallelism.html(使用谷歌翻译): 术语并发和并行性通常用于多线程程序。但是,并发和并行性究竟是什么意思呢,它们是相同的术语还是什么? 简短的答案是“不 ...
分类:编程语言   时间:2017-06-16 09:19:14    收藏:0  评论:0  赞:0  阅读:387
java文件和目录的增删复制
在使用java进行开发时常常会用到文件和目录的增删复制等方法。我写了一个小工具类。和大家分享,希望大家指正: package com.wangpeng.utill; import java.io.File; import java.io.FileInputStream; import java.io ...
分类:编程语言   时间:2017-06-16 09:19:00    收藏:0  评论:0  赞:0  阅读:223
17、Java并发性和多线程-避免死锁
以下内容转自http://ifeve.com/deadlock-prevention/: 在有些情况下死锁是可以避免的。本文将展示三种用于避免死锁的技术: 加锁顺序 当多个线程需要相同的一些锁,但是按照不同的顺序加锁,死锁就很容易发生。 如果能确保所有的线程都是按照相同的顺序获得锁,那么死锁就不会发 ...
分类:编程语言   时间:2017-06-16 09:18:21    收藏:0  评论:0  赞:0  阅读:221
疯狂Java学习笔记(72)-----------大话程序猿面试
大话程序猿面试 10个我最喜欢问程序猿的面试问题程序猿面试不全然指南10个经典的C语言面试基础算法及代码程序猿的10大成功面试技巧程序猿选择公司的8个标准 编程开发 8个值得关注的PHP安全函数简析TCP的三次握手与四次分手10分钟掌握XML、JSON及其解析高效的jQuery代码编写技巧总结编译器 ...
分类:编程语言   时间:2017-06-16 09:17:18    收藏:0  评论:0  赞:0  阅读:305
python---三级菜单
三级菜单,比较low级别的,后续学习函数调用 ...
分类:编程语言   时间:2017-06-16 09:16:02    收藏:0  评论:0  赞:0  阅读:329
Python生成唯一id的方法
1.使用uuid 2.使用hashlib+time - 示例1: - 示例2: ...
分类:编程语言   时间:2017-06-16 09:15:19    收藏:0  评论:0  赞:0  阅读:384
eclipse中tomcat无法加载spring boot
转自: http://blog.csdn.net/u010797575/article/details/50517777 最近搭建一套spring boot框架,作为 application 启动项目OK, 但将 spring boot web放入 自己配置的tomcat容器中,出现不加载sprin ...
分类:编程语言   时间:2017-06-16 09:14:40    收藏:0  评论:0  赞:0  阅读:418
Spring AOP 在XML中声明切面
转载地址:http://www.jianshu.com/p/43a0bc21805f 在XML中将一个Java类配置成一个切面: AOP元素用途定义AOP通知器定义一个后置通知(不管目标方法是否执行成功)定义AOP返回通知定义AOP异常通知定义环绕通知定义一个切面启动@AspectJ注解驱动的切面定... ...
分类:编程语言   时间:2017-06-16 09:13:41    收藏:0  评论:0  赞:0  阅读:369
Spring AOP 面向切面编程
AOP 在软件业,AOP为Aspect Oriented Programming的缩写,意为:面向切面编程,通过预编译方式和运行期动态代理实现程序功能的统一维护的一种技术。AOP是OOP的延续,是软件开发中的一个热点,也是Spring框架中的一个重要内容,是函数式编程的一种衍生范型。利用AOP可以对... ...
分类:编程语言   时间:2017-06-15 23:30:46    收藏:0  评论:0  赞:0  阅读:361
[分布式系统学习] 6.824 LEC2 RPC和线程 笔记
6.824的课程通常是在课前让你做一些准备。一般来说是先读一篇论文,然后请你提一个问题,再请你回答一个问题。然后上课,然后布置Lab。 第二课的准备-Crawler 第二课的准备不是论文,是让你实现Go Tour里面的crawler。Go Tour里面原有的实现是串行的,并且可能爬到相同的url。要 ...
分类:编程语言   时间:2017-06-15 23:29:18    收藏:0  评论:0  赞:0  阅读:430
Java学习:HTML入门
HTML HTML基本标签 <html> --html开始标签 <head> -- 文件头(用户在浏览器的主体是看不到的) </head> <body> --文件体(用户在浏览器的主体看得到) </body></html> --html结束标签 <!-- -->这是html的注释标签的形式。 <me ...
分类:编程语言   时间:2017-06-15 23:28:04    收藏:0  评论:0  赞:1  阅读:517
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!